WebOct 12, 2024 · Many banks make the majority of their money from charging interest on loaned funds, such as home loans, auto loans or personal loans that are issued to consumers. Many banks also offer loans to small and large businesses. Customers who have a credit card and revolve a balance may also pay interest on their credit card debt. WebSep 15, 2024 · Origination fees are usually charged at a rate between 0.5 to 1% of the mortgage value. So, on a house valued at $380,000 you would pay $1900 if the origination fee is calculated at 0.5% and $3,800 at a rate of 1%. It all ties back to the fundamental way banks make money: Banks use depositors’ money to make loans. The amount of interest the banks collect on the loans is greater than the amount of interest they pay to customers with savings accounts—and the difference is the banks’ profit. highest rated team on fifa 16
